    Trailer Lighting

    Guys, got a new/used trailer with the family boat.... It needs help, espically in the lighting dept. Any ideas or pointers? I was just going to go to west marine and get one of those "kits" and go from their. I figured with some heat-shrink crimps and some liquid-electric-tape on top of the connectors I should be good to go?? Any brands/styles to stay away from?

    Run a dedicated ground wire down each side of the trailer frame. Don't rely on the frame itself for your ground connections.
